This comprehensive course equips professionals with practical knowledge of the DMAIC methodology, statistical tools, and Lean principles to lead process improvement projects. Topics include project charters, VOC, root cause analysis, hypothesis testing, DOE, Lean tools (5S, Kanban, Poka-Yoke)
